Karnataka Examination Authority “KEA” is the Governing body which is responsible for conducting neet counseling process for MBBS and BDS Counseling will be conducted for the 85% Government & 100% Private Medical & Dental seats. It’s an open State, which means students from other State can apply for seats under management quota in Private Medical Colleges in Karnataka There are 21 Government, 30 Private and 12 Deemed Medical colleges in Karnataka.. Seat Allotment for Deemed will be done through centralized Medical Counseling Committee (MCC) There are 3 rounds of counseling process which includes “Round 1”, “Round 2” and “Mop up” rounds will be conducted online. If seats are vacant after mop up then college round will be conducted, also known as “Stray round or College level Spot Round”
